@pbuttigieg recently suggested switching to Dublin Core annotation properties, as opposed to of oboInOwl.

The NMDC team has been using oboInOwl in our templates, like NMDC-03_EnvO_template_robot_sheet

That's based on @kaiiam's nice EnvO/robot documentation

I have checked for predicate usage in EnvO via http://sparql.hegroup.org/sparql/

Remember there are two different Dublin Core prefixes.

     xmlns:dc="http://purl.org/dc/elements/1.1/"
     xmlns:terms="http://purl.org/dc/terms/"

cmungall commented 2 years ago

Thanks for this analysis

The very first thing that should be done is replace elements with terms. This should not be controversial. See https://github.com/OBOFoundry/OBOFoundry.github.io/issues/540

I am not sure that the question should be "dc vs oio". There are no synonyms in dc for example.

I would strongly advocate for ENVO continuing to use

oboInOwl:hasBroadSynonym@en oboInOwl:hasExactSynonym@en oboInOwl:hasNarrowSynonym@en oboInOwl:hasRelatedSynonym@en

for synonyms (there is no equivalent for this in dc. there is also no direct equivalent in skos, as skos predicates map between concept URIs, and should not be used for literals)

I would also recommend keeping on using

oboInOwl:inSubset

for subsets

and

oboInOwl:hasDbXref

on axiom annotations for provenenance

This will all be made clearer with the next OMO release

I think your analysis is showing a lot of terms from other ontologies. I am not sure it's the best use of your time to redo on envo-base as this will all be folded into OMO-based validation tools soon.
